Jolimont (NZ) Commanding in Group Three Founders Cup Victory
18 March 2025
Jolimont (NZ) (Sweet Lou) lived up to his outstanding form with his powerful front-running win in the $37,000 Group Three Lincoln Farms Founders Cup (1700m) at Alexandra Park on Friday night.
The five-year-old reeled off electric closing sectionals giving his rivals no chance of catching him, as he scored for trainer Arna Donnelly and driver Tony Herlihy.
Jolimont produced brilliant results when campaigning through the spring and early summer, including setting a new Alexandra Park allcomers track record for 1700m.
Though the pacer had been freshened since his creditable last start fifth in the Group One Auckland Cup (3200m), he was primed and ready for another outstanding 1700m display.
Donnelly is now hopeful Jolimont is ready to further establish himself in open class.
“They get there quick and then they’ve got to learn to race the big boys,” the trainer said.
“Last year he probably plateaued a little bit by the end of it, but hopefully this year is his year.”
Herlihy worked Jolimont an early lead on Friday night and as his rivals approached, he cruised to a comfortable victory.
“When Jeremiah (NZ) (Lazarus) came out we made a change to our plans,” Donnelly said.
“He loves being in front and he loves the distance.”
Jolimont was secured by his trainer for $31,000 when he was offered among the Woodlands Stud draft at the 2021 National Yearling Sale at Karaka.
The pacer took his career earnings to $232,231 with his victory on Friday night.
